Two years ago Kamara was forced to start against Alabama and he was obviously very talented.

I watched the entire game in Tennessee and was flabbergasted at how easy Kamara performed against Bama's defense. I knew nothing about him whatsoever until that game. I asked some folks who the hell he was and found out about his story.

Tennessee used him that game very similarly to how the Saints are doing now. And, he made Bama's backers look foolish.

Guice is talented and will be successful in the league, but he doesn't have the all-around tools Kamara has and it isn't even close.

That is not a knock, Kamara is a revolutionary back. He is just as big as Guice also at 215.

Fournette is his own type back.

He wears down defenses or he forces defenses to have to stack the mine of scrimmage. I still believe he is a little too impatient hitting his holes/reads even at JAX, but when he gets to the second level he is a machine and punishes defensive backs and linebackers with a head of steam.

Kamara has patience, vision, but he doesn't wear down defenses or punish them for tackling him.

If Fournette can ever develop his skills presnap looking over the line and defense and afterwards be patient with his blocks and visualize the blocks opening up the holes like Leveon Bell does he will be an all time great in my opinion. That is my only knock of Fournette and believe he will have that figured out the next couple of years.
